CXX definitely has more memory than Siege.  I spooled my daughter's baitcast reel with 12# CXX because she fishes a Senko all the time.  (Doesn't get out much.)  She complained about casting problems due to memory.  I re-spooled the reel with 12# Siege.  Hasn't complained since.

 

I'm like michaelb.  Lots of good lines...not enough time (or money) to test them all.  I also use 12# Big Game.  Little more memory than Siege.  Works well after getting wet.  First few casts I can get fluff on the spool if not careful.  Siege, no.  However, the first few casts with Siege has the line in front of the reel looking like a slinky.  Doesn't fluff on the spool, tho.
